What is the meaning of Christmas Day December 24/25th & Epiphany January 6th?
Christmas the night of Dec 24/25th the Nativity of Jesus being born is the first celebration of the King and Savior to Christians as Christmas Day.
Epiphany ~ Jan 6th even if you're not Christian based, this is what "Christmas Gifts" are based on. And for future reference, only after Epiphany should you remove Christmas decorations, for on January 6th, The Three Wise Men are led by the Star of Bethlehem to Baby Jesus to share their gifts, with the King and Savior.
